2. 准备一个对象数据,用于绑定到 el-select 在你的 Vue 组件的 data 函数中,定义一个数组 options,其中包含你要绑定的对象,以及一个 selectedObject 用于存储选中的对象。 javascript data() { return { options: [ { id: 1, name: '选项1' }, { id: 2, name: '选项2' }, { id: 3, name: '...
当我们使用 Elemet UI 的选择组件进行多选时,Select 组件的绑定值是一个数组,但是数组的值只能传入 Number 类型或者 String 类型的数据,如果我们想向其中传入一个对象就会出错,比如: image.png 我们可以发现其为缺少一个索引,翻查 elemnet-ui 的文档,可以查阅到 Select 组件有一个属性: image.png 那么,我们可以...
觉得这应该是你使用不正确才会出现的原因,通常情况下 v-model 绑定的数据应该包含在 options 数组里面 但是如果我绑定普通类型的值,例如字符串,如果options中没有的话也不会出现空标签的情况,可以看这个demo Author Mr-Nobody-li commented Feb 20, 2023 但是如果我绑定普通类型的值,例如字符串,如果options中没...
此时我的value绑定的为item(选项对象),注意下列例子为 多选 情况 绑定值为对象 label绑定值为userName // item实例item={userId:'1',userName:'user004'} <el-selectv-model="selectedList"//将选中的值绑定到集合selectedList中multipleref="selectDom"placeholder="请选择"><el-option v-for="item in optio...
element plus select选中值为对象 el-select获取选中值 前言 最近在开发时总遇到一些起奇奇怪怪的需求,例如el-select组件需要同时获取用户选中的label值跟value值,据后台人员说是只传一个value匹配不上数据。害,这还不简单,那我就都传过去呗,下面给大家分享几种快速拿到用户选中label值的方法。
</el-select> 这里绑定的下拉框的数据源是一个ddlbOption这个对象数组,这是一个请求后台数据返回的键值对的数组。 首先需要声明这个对象数组 data() { return { // 调动类别字典 ddlbOptions: [], 1. 然后在页面的created函数中请求后台获取字典数据,这样在页面加载完就能获取数据。
</el-select> 这里绑定的下拉框的数据源是一个ddlbOption这个对象数组,这是一个请求后台数据返回的键值对的数组。 首先需要声明这个对象数组 data() {return{//调动类别字典ddlbOptions: [], 然后在页面的created函数中请求后台获取字典数据,这样在页面加载完就能获取数据。
要确保 `el-select` 组件的回显成功,其中 `v-model` 绑定的是一个数组,你需要按照以下步骤进行操作: 1. 在 `el-option` 组件上使用 `:value` 属性设置每个选项的值,确保每个选项都有唯一的标识。 2. 在 `el-select` 组件上使用 `:multiple="true"` 属性来启用多选模式。
2.创建el-select组件:在HTML中创建一个el-select组件,用于展示选项列表。 3.创建el-option组件:在el-select中使用el-option组件来展示选项。每个el-option组件代表一个选项,可以设置其value属性来指定选项的值,并设置label属性来指定选项的显示文本。 4.绑定选项值:使用v-model指令将el-select的值与数据对象进行绑定...
el-select绑定值为对象时,报错[Vue warn]: <transition-group> children must be keyed: <ElTag> 问题是因为后台接口返回来的一个label是null,所以选中的时候会报错 1.结构 <divclass="clear"v-if="item.remindType==2&&showMoreRemind"><el-form-itemstyle="padding-left:15px;"prop="moreRemind"class="...